About This Item

New York: The Myriade Press, 1968. Third printing. . Hardcover. Good. 4to. A good copy with some dents to front cover tail and a few minor damp spots to cloth. Rippling to tail of a few pages. White and red dw has 2" closed tear to spine/front cover top and scuffing and minor losses to spine top and tail, wear to corners.
